Guitar Hero for iPhone Now At App Store

If you were paying attention to Steve Jobs keynote at WWDC 2010 you will know that music game Guitar Hero has now entered the Apple iTunes App Store for the iPhone and iPod Touch.

So if you iPhone toting Guitar Hero fans out there want to strum your music you can now grab Guitar Hero for iPhone right from the App Store at a cost of $2.99 reports Leanna Lofte over at tipb.

Guitar Hero for iPhone features social integration for sharing with Facebook, view leaderboards and strong avatar customisation and includes such song as “We Are The Champions” by Queen, “Paint It Black” by The Rolling Stones, “Say It Ain’t So,” by Weezer, “Savior” by Rise Against, and “Cousins” by Vampire Weekend.

With Guitar Hero for iPhone the user can “play” songs by strumming, tapping and sliding to the music, and can furthermore download song packs through in-app purchase.
